How much homework will my child have every night?

Homework depends upon how much the teacher gets through in a day and the 
needs of the student.  Expect that you child will have homework everyday in 
Math.

What will my student learn in Math this year?

Your student will begin with a simple review, then move to algebra, 
fractions/decimals, geometry, probability, and graphing.  The order of topics 
may change during the year due to timing and ISATs.

How does my student make up absent homework?

If a student is absent, they will have 2 days for every 1 day they are 
absent.  Your student is responsible for asking the teacher for make-up 
work.
